Welcome back to Syracuse Speaks! This podcast, hosted by Alex Ackerman, aims to bring more voices to the world of minor league hockey.

This week, Alex takes a look at the Syracuse Crunch’s North Division-heavy January slate of games. She also discusses some team events coming up, and recaps some of the bigger headlines since she last recorded. She briefly touches on forward Daniel Walcott’s suspension before turning her focus to the sold naming rights for the War Memorial Upstate Medical University Arena at Onondaga County War Memorial.
